* MacOS-specific glue for using FSSpecs to deal with srvtabs.
*/
#include "krb.h"
#include "krb4int.h"
#include <stdio.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<Kerberos/FSpUtils.h>
/*
* These functions are compiled in for ABI compatibility with older versions of KfM.
* They are deprecated so they do not appear in the KfM headers anymore.
*
* Do not change their ABIs!
*/
int KRB5_CALLCONV FSp_krb_get_svc_in_tkt (char *, char *, char *, char *, char *, int, const FSSpec *);
int KRB5_CALLCONV FSp_put_svc_key (const FSSpec *, char *, char *, char *, int, char *);
int KRB5_CALLCONV FSp_read_service_key (char *, char *, char *, int, const FSSpec*, char *);
static int FSp_srvtab_to_key (char *, char *, char *, char *, C_Block);
int KRB5_CALLCONV
FSp_read_service_key(
char *service, /* Service Name */
char *instance, /* Instance name or "*" */
char *realm, /* Realm */
int kvno, /* Key version number */
const FSSpec *filespec, /* Filespec */
char *key) /* Pointer to key to be filled in */
{
int retval = KFAILURE;
char file [MAXPATHLEN];
if (filespec != NULL) {
if (FSSpecToPOSIXPath (filespec, file, sizeof(file)) != noErr) {
return retval;
}
}
retval = read_service_key(service, instance, realm, kvno, file, key);
if (file != NULL) {
free (file);
}
return retval;
}
int KRB5_CALLCONV
FSp_put_svc_key(
const FSSpec *sfilespec,
char *name,
char *inst,
char *realm,
int newvno,
char *key)
{
int retval = KFAILURE;
char sfile[MAXPATHLEN];
if (sfilespec != NULL) {
if (FSSpecToPOSIXPath (sfilespec, sfile, sizeof(sfile)) != noErr) {
return retval;
}
}
retval = put_svc_key(sfile, name, inst, realm, newvno, key);
if (sfile != NULL) {
free (sfile);
}
return retval;
}
int KRB5_CALLCONV
FSp_krb_get_svc_in_tkt(
char *user, char *instance, char *realm,
char *service, char *sinstance, int life,
const FSSpec *srvtab)
{
/* Cast the FSSpec into the password field. It will be pulled out again */
/* by FSp_srvtab_to_key and used to read the real password */
return krb_get_in_tkt(user, instance, realm, service, sinstance,
life, FSp_srvtab_to_key, NULL, (char *)srvtab);
}
static int FSp_srvtab_to_key(char *user, char *instance, char *realm,
char *srvtab, C_Block key)
{
/* FSp_read_service_key correctly handles a NULL FSSpecPtr */
return FSp_read_service_key(user, instance, realm, 0,
(FSSpec *)srvtab, (char *)key);
}
